3.  Installation
Safety Precautions
p~ÑÉíó=mêÉÅ~ìíáçåë=
For all BlendPRO-II installation procedures, observe the following important safety and 
handling rules to avoid damage to yourself and the equipment:
To protect users from electric shock, ensure that the power supplies for each unit 
connect to earth via the ground wire provided in the AC power Cord.
The AC Socket-outlet should be installed near the equipment and be easily 
accessible.

Before opening the BlendPRO-II box, inspect it for damage.  If you find any damage, notify 
the shipping carrier immediately for all claims adjustments.  As you open the box, compare 
its contents against the packing slip.  If you find any shortages, contact your Barco sales 
representative. 
Once you have removed all the components from their packaging and checked that all the 
listed components are present, visually inspect each unit to ensure there was no damage 
during shipping.  If there is damage, notify the shipping carrier immediately for all claims 
adjustments.

The environment in which you install your BlendPRO-II(s) should be clean, properly lit, free 
from static, and have adequate power, ventilation, and space for all components.
